Zevra Therapeutics reported Q1 2026 earnings per share (EPS) of $0.18, significantly surpassing the estimate of $0.0824 by 118.45%. Revenue was not disclosed, and the stock fell by 4.39% following the announcement. The EPS beat appears primarily attributable to non-operating gains rather than core business revenue.

The headline EPS beat of $0.18 versus the $0.0824 consensus reflects a substantial positive surprise, though the absence of reported revenue suggests the earnings power came from non-core activities. In prior quarters, Zevra has recorded gains from licensing fees, settlement income, or changes in the fair value of contingent liabilities. Without revenue disclosure, investors cannot assess top-line growth or product uptake. The company’s business model remains centered on its rare disease pipeline, including therapies for cystinosis and acromegaly. Operating expenses may have been managed tightly, but the lack of revenue or margin data limits detailed analysis of underlying operational performance. The EPS surprise of 118.45% indicates that analysts had not anticipated these one-time or non-recurring contributions.

Zevra may continue to focus on regulatory milestones, such as the ongoing review of its lead candidate for cystinosis in the U.S. and Europe. The company anticipates potential approval decisions in the coming quarters, which could drive future revenue and stock sentiment. However, risk factors include the uncertainty of regulatory outcomes, competition from existing therapies, and a limited commercial infrastructure. Without a run-rate of product sales, the company’s financial performance may remain volatile, dependent on partnership milestones or financing events. Investors should look for updates on clinical trial enrollment and any strategic collaborations that could provide near-term cash inflows.

Despite the large EPS beat, Zevra shares declined by 4.39%, suggesting the market viewed the earnings quality as low or that the beat was driven by unsustainable items. Analysts may revise estimates downward for future quarters to exclude the one-time gain—or adjust models to reflect the absence of product revenue. The stock price reaction implies that investors are waiting for clearer evidence of commercial progress. Key catalysts to watch include the FDA’s decision on the cystinosis therapy, expected in the second half of the year, and any early sales data once commercial launch begins. Without those, the stock may remain range-bound. The current valuation likely hinges on pipeline potential rather than current earnings power.
